Fiber and Material

The type of fiber plays a major role in the feel, weight, and appearance of a sheet set. Three common materials found in bed sheets are cotton, bamboo, and linen.

Cotton: Probably the most common material found in bed sheets, cotton sheets come in a variety of styles. Long-staple cotton, which has long, fine fibers, makes high-quality, durable bed sheets. Egyptian and Pima cottons are examples of long-staple cotton. Saatva uses long-staple cotton in its luxury sheet sets, such as its Signature Sateen Sheet Set and the Percale Sheet Set.

Bamboo: Silky with a natural sheen, bamboo is a sustainable, rapidly renewable material. It’s also highly breathable, making it a great option for warmer seasons.

Linen: Although coarser in texture than cotton or bamboo, linen sheets become softer with multiple washings. Linen is highly durable and typically lasts through years of use and washing. Weave Style

The best bed sheets are often made with percale or sateen weave. Cotton percale is made with a one-under, one-over weave that creates a light, breathable fabric. Sateen sheets are made with a three-over or four-over, one-under weave. This technique gives the fabric its characteristic sheen and slightly silky texture. Thread Count

Thread count refers to a fabric’s number of threads per inch. The best thread count depends on personal preference, but the sweet spot is generally between 250 and 800. A thread count of 1000 or above produces a thicker, less breathable material and may be woven from shorter, lower-quality fibers. An exception to the preferred 250-800 range is linen, which is coarser and often falls within the 80-150 range.
